Sunsoka FAQs
Q:
How long will a Timbertime Sunsoka pool take to
assemble?
A: In respect of all models that
do not have the steel side supports, being the
BZ3440, BZ4848 and BZ3434, with a hand picked
team of family helpers this should take a weekend,
assuming the ground has been prepared. Water finds
it's own level so do ensure the base is prepared
correctly.
Q: Do I require any tools?
A: There are tools in the
kit - but in addition you will need a battery drill,
manly enough to insert some 100+ stainless steel
screws. Drill bits should be 3mm - 4mm. Best to
get a couple just in case! You will also need 50mm
wide masking tape and a stick of chalk. If you are
buying the larger pool range then you will also
need spanners - 19 mm ring spanner.
Q: Can I submerge the pool in the ground?
A: Yes - a lot of owners do. The sensible height
out of the ground is around 750mm - this gives a
nice height to sit on and still assists as a wind
barrier against dust blowing into the pool.
Q: What type of base shall
I require?
A: For longevity you should
consider installing a sound concrete base. Having
said that, many pools are assembled directly on
to a soil base - watch out for drains - and any
services that may need accessing in the future.
There should be no sharp edges, or tree roots etc.
Q: Can the pool be heated?
A: Yes - speak with your
pool shop. They will advise you. You may be able
to use your domestic boiler!
Q: Can I make the pool
any deeper?
A: Yes - by 150mm. This means
you will need a deeper liner.
Q: What is the cost of running the pool including
water treatment products?
A: Use £9 a week as an average - this is without
heating. The cost can vary depending on use and
weather conditions.
Q: Does the wood need treating?
A: The timber used in all
Sunsoka models is pressure treated to give you years
of service. For aesthetic reasons it is a good idea
to bring out the grain annually, using a recognized
wood preserver. Don't let any preserver get in the
water as it will stain the liner.
Q:
Do I need a qualified electrician?
A: Yes, do not attempt any
electrical work unless you are qualified. Speak
with your pool supplier, they generally have an
electrician on their staff.
